Championnat de France des Rallyes (CFR)
- 9 events (all tarmac)
- WRC 1.6T, WRC 2.0, S2000, R5, RRC, GT+ (local big GT), ...
- Jean Marie Cuoq / Jérôme Degout (C4 WRC)
Championnat de France des Rallyes Terre (CFRT)
- 6 events (all gravel)
- WRC 1.6T, WRC 2.0, S2000, R5, RRC ...
- Jean Marie Cuoq / Marielle Grandemange (C4 WRC)
Championnat de France des Rallyes 2ème Division (CFR D2)
- 15 events (all tarmac)
- WRC 1.6T, WRC 2.0, S2000, R5, RRC, GT+ ...
- Eric Brunson / Cédric Mondon (Fiesta WRC)

2016 MSA British Rally Championship
Events
Mid Wales Stages 5/6 March Gravel
Circuit of Ireland 8/9 April Asphalt
Pirelli Carlisle Rally 30 April/1 May Gravel
Jim Clark Rally 3/4 June Asphalt
RSAC Scottish Rally 24/25 June Gravel
Ulster Rally19/20 AugustAsphalt
Granite City Rally 9/10 September Gravel
Classes
BRC 1
FIA R5, S2000, RRC, Group R4 (VR4). Example makes are Citroen, Ford, Peugeot, Skoda, Mitsubishi R4, Subaru R4
BRC RGT
An exciting class that is currently lead by the Porsche and the awesome sound that comes with it.
BRC 2
This is for the current FIA Grp N class and for ASN homologation extended Grp N cars over 2000cc.
BRC JUNIOR
For drivers under 26 years of age in R2 homologated cars, competing for a prize fund to assist the following year‘s campaign.
BRC 3
The class for FIA R3 cars that has been dominated by Citroen‘s DS3 in the past but which also includes the Toyota GT86 and Renault Clio.
BRC 4
For competitors with R2 cars that aren’t eligible for BRC Junior, this is the home for them.
BRC 5
The starting step for homologated rallying and the FIA R1 class of cars.
NATIONAL CHAMPIONSHIP CARS
Open to all cars with a current MSA Rally Car Log Book. The same events as the BRC but no recce on the gravel rounds.

Latvian Rally Championship 2015
Events
Rally Sarma 23/24 January Snow
Rally Liepāja (each day as seperate national event) 07/08 February Snow/Gravel
Rally Talsi 16/17 May Gravel
Rally 300 Lakes 07/08 August Gravel
Rally Kurzeme 27/28 August Gravel
Rally Tartu 25/26 September Gravel
Rally Latvija 17/18 October Tarmac/Gravel
Groups:
LRC1 (RRC, R5, R4, S2000, A8, N4, L13/12/11)
LRC2 (N4)
LRC3 (N1/2/3, A5/6, R1/2, L10/9)
RK1 /rally cup/ (R3, A7, L13-8)
L classes are national ones, cars with invalid international homologation
Results:
LRC1
1. Guntis Lielkājis / Vilnis Miķelsons Lancer Evo IX
2. Elviss Hermanis / Gatis Veilands Lancer Evo VIII
3. Jānis Berķis / Edgars Čeporjus Lancer Evo IX
LRC2
1. Siim Plangi / Marek Sarapuu (EST) Lancer Evo X
2. Jānis Vorobjovs / Andris Mālnieks Lancer Evo X
3. Mārtiņš Svilis / Ivo Pūķis Lancer Evo X
LRC3
1. Ralfs Sirmacis / Artūrs Šimins Ford Fiesta R2
2. Nikolay Gryazin / Yaroslav Fedorov Peugeot 208 R2
3. Emīls Blūms / 3 different codrivers Ford Fiesta R2
LRK
1. Edgars Balodis / Inese Akmentiņa Honda Civic Type-R
2. Egidijus Valeiša / Povilas Reisas (LT) BMW M3
3. Mikhail Skripnikov / Alexei Krylov (RUS) Renault Clio R3
